 What is Microneedling?

 First things first, Microneedling, also known as collagen induction therapy, involves using a device with tiny needles to puncture the skin. These micro-injuries stimulate the body's natural healing process, and stimulate Qi, encouraging the production of collagen and elastin, which results in smoother, more youthful-looking skin.

 The Problem with Derma Rollers and Low RPM Non-Medical Grade Oscillating Devices

 Microneedling can be performed with a derma roller or an oscillating device, but not all devices are created equal (or anywhere close to equal). For example, professional-grade microneedling pens start at 3 to 4K$ and go up from there, while home-use oscillating pens start at just a few hundred dollars.

 What's the difference? The most significant difference in terms of how they affect your skin is RPMs (rotations per minute). The higher the RPMs, the less drag the needles have on your skin, reducing the risk of scarring. Medical-grade devices have incredibly high RPMs and stimulate collagen and elastin production with zero damage to your skin.

 Speaking of drag, derma roller devices are tough on your skin because the needles on the roller head enter and exit your skin very slowly by comparison. Even worse, due to the round roller head, they enter and exit your skin at an angle, creating more drag and increasing the risk of scarring, hyperpigmentation, and even nerve damage.

 1. Precision

Medical-grade oscillating devices offer far greater precision than derma rollers or home-use devices. The depth of the punctures is adjustable based on the patient's skin type and the specific concerns being addressed. In addition, once adjusted, they penetrate the skin at a consistent depth and frequency, resulting in better collagen production and more visible results.

 2. Safety

Medical-grade oscillating devices are your safest option for microneedling treatments. Derma rollers can introduce bacteria into the skin, leading to infection. Derma roller needles can also cause small tears in the skin (rather than precision punctures), making it easier for bacteria to enter the body and increasing recovery time.

Medical-grade devices have much finer needles, and the heads are sterile, single-use, and disposable, mitigating the risk of infection and cross-contamination.

Medical professionals understand the importance of sterilization and use sterile tools and surfaces for every patient.

 How Long Does It Take to See Results From MicroNeedling?

 You may notice some results after about a week, but most patients report noticeable results after three treatments and continued improvement with each treatment thereafter. This is because it takes some time for your body's natural healing processes to kick in and begin stimulating collagen production. Depending on your skin type and condition, you may need several treatments before seeing significant results. In general, most people begin with  3-6 microneedling treatments spaced 4 weeks apart, with occasional follow-ups to achieve and maintain optimal results.
